Output 26185752daabd94a7dfee22eac99f1d10da08040c14bde75393d45e6007ff28a:6

value
5111776
script pubkey
OP_0 OP_PUSHBYTES_20 30b38f62efb7a72af6d8422f34d5f3167856c0bf
address
bc1qxzec7ch0k7nj4akcgghnf40nzeu9ds9leahcrt
transaction
26185752daabd94a7dfee22eac99f1d10da08040c14bde75393d45e6007ff28a